Port `test_some_cancels_all` off `run_in_actor`

Second `test_cancellation.py` group of the `run_in_actor` removal
(#477),

- one-shot subactors now run as concurrent `to_actor.run(fn,
  an=an)` tasks in a local `trio` task-nursery, so their errors
  raise WHILE the actor-nursery block is open (vs the legacy
  teardown-reap) and the first error cancels sibling one-shots.
- wrap the task-nursery in `collapse_eg()` so the deterministic
  single-error cases still surface a bare `RemoteActorError`.
- loosen the group-shape assertion: the relay-vs-cancel race
  populates anywhere from 1 to `num_actors` `RemoteActorError`s
  (the exact-`num_actors` BEG was `run_in_actor`'s
  reap-all-at-teardown); group members are always
  `RemoteActorError` now since sibling `trio.Cancelled`s are
  absorbed by the task-nursery.
- move the daemon-portal call loop inside the task-nursery body
  so the sleep-forever one-shot case is cancelled by the daemon
  error raise.
- rename the `*run_in_actor*` param ids to `*one_shot*`.

Gate: 6 passed on both `trio` + `mp_spawn` backends.
